Breastfeeding Transmission
refers to the passing of
Infectious Agents
or
Substances from a lactating mother
to her infant through
Breast milk
. This can include
Viruses like HIV
,
Certain Medications
, or
Environmental Toxins
, necessitating careful consideration of
Maternal Health
and
Treatment Options
to
Protect the infant
.
